Defining Trends: Maison Margiela's effect on Contemporary Fashion
Maison Margiela has undeniably left an enduring mark on the contemporary fashion landscape. Founded by the enigmatic Martin Margiela in 1988, the brand quickly gained notoriety for its avant-garde aesthetic and deconstructionist approach to clothing. Celebrating a philosophy of anonymity and subversion, Margiela challenged traditional notions of beauty and elegance, instead championing vintage garments and unconventional silhouettes. This bold vision resonated with a generation craving individuality, catapulting Maison Margiela to the forefront of fashion's intellectual discourse.
The brand's influence extends far beyond its runway displays, permeating streetwear, luxury, and even everyday style. From its signature white stickers and numbered collections to its collaborations with artists and designers, Maison Margiela continues to shape the contemporary aesthetic, inspiring a new generation of creatives to innovate.
